Description

Stained Glass
King Rene's honeymoon
About 1863

The designs for these panels were originally made for a cabinet. They depict incidents from the honeymoon of King Rene, who was endowed with a love of fine arts. The stained glass was made by Morris, Marshall, Faulkner & Co., London, for the house of the painter Myles Birket Foster at Whitley, Surrey.

Stained and painted glass
Museum no. Circ.516-1953
